Alaeddin Boroujerdi:

Saudi Arabia worried about expanding wave of Islamic Awakening

Tehran, June 6, (ICANA) – Member of Iran's Majlis Alaeddin Boroujerdi says that Saudi Arabia's recent claim about Iran's nuclear program is only a ploy to divert the public opinion from the regional developments.

In an interview with ICANA on Wednesday, Boroujerdi said, "The recent claims made by Saudi foreign minister Saud al-Faisal over Iran's nuclear program is in line with Riyadh's general policy to underestimate the developments in the Arab world and divert the public opinion from the Arab spring.

He further noted that such remarks prove that Saudi monarchy is deeply worried about the contagious effects of the Islamic awakening.

"Saud al-Faisal should express concern about the threats imposed by Israel and its big nuclear arsenal," he added.
